Melissa Gilbert opened up about dating Rob Lowe in the early years of her career on the I Choose Me podcast.
The Little House on the Prairie star and host Jennie Garth reflected on the early relationships they had at the beginning of their fame.
Having dated him from 1981 to 1987, she remarked, “I guess looking back on those six years, I mean, I was such a baby when Rob and I were together. I was 17 and we broke up for the last time when we were 23 and it was very tumultuous.”
“I felt like a bit of an old sage in the business at that point because I'd been doing it for so long,” she continued. “And I was still on Little House on the Prairie when we met, and it had already been years, and he was sort of starting out. He'd done a little bit of television. And so I was able to sort of sit back and watch this meteoric rise happen.”
“I don't think I was prepared for the stuff that came with it, necessarily,” the actress admitted. “I was prepared for all of having to go to premieres and things and award shows and all of that, but I wasn't prepared for the fandom and frankly, the girls.”
“I always thought that every girl and woman was my sister. We're sisters, but it was not evident at all when Rob and I were a couple,” Gilbert recalled. “I mean, it was like I didn't exist. They just pushed right past me and stick phone numbers in his pockets and stuff.”
“To say it was disconcerting is doing it a big disservice,” she explained. “It was hard and horrible. I think I learned a lot about what didn't work for me, actually, and what I wouldn't stand for later on.”
“They hurt. They’re hard because they usually are born of heartbreak and angst, but those are really valuable and important lessons… We had some really, really, really fun times,” the actress acquiesced.
